Kids ask questions adults don’t always know how to answer.
Not because adults don’t care.
Not because kids are wrong to ask.
But because some questions don’t come with easy endings.

In this book, Calvin—a curious kid with a thoughtful mind—and Pudge—his loyal, snack-loving beagle—wander through everyday moments that turn into something bigger. Dinner tables. Classrooms. Walks around the neighborhood. Quiet nights when thoughts won’t settle down.
Each chapter begins with a question many kids have asked…
and many adults have avoided.
Why do grown-ups pretend not to be afraid?
Why do people hide sadness?
Why does trying your best still hurt sometimes?
This isn’t a book about having all the answers.
It’s a book about noticing.
Listening.
And learning that curiosity doesn’t disappear when you grow up—it just needs room to breathe.
Whether you’re reading this as a child, a parent, a teacher, or someone who still wonders quietly about the world, this story invites you to do one simple thing:
Stay curious.
And don’t stop asking.
